4GLB
Structure of p-nitrobenzaldehyde inhibited lipase from Thermomyces lanuginosa at 2.69 A resolution
Experimental procedure
Experimental method | SINGLE WAVELENGTH |
Source type | SYNCHROTRON |
Source details | ESRF BEAMLINE BM14 |
Synchrotron site | ESRF |
Beamline | BM14 |
Temperature [K] | 77 |
Detector technology | CCD |
Collection date | 2012-05-26 |
Detector | MARRESEARCH |
Wavelength(s) | 0.97 |
Spacegroup name | P 61 |
Unit cell lengths | 139.911, 139.911, 80.448 |
Unit cell angles | 90.00, 90.00, 120.00 |
Refinement procedure
Resolution | 50.000 - 2.690 |
R-factor | 0.1635 |
Rwork | 0.161 |
R-free | 0.20543 |
Structure solution method | MOLECULAR REPLACEMENT |
Starting model (for MR) | 4ea6 |
RMSD bond length | 0.008 |
RMSD bond angle | 1.078 |
Data reduction software | HKL-2000 |
Data scaling software | SCALEPACK |
Phasing software | AMoRE |
Refinement software | REFMAC (5.5.0109) |
Data quality characteristics
Overall | Outer shell | |
Low resolution limit [Å] | 50.000 | 2.740 |
High resolution limit [Å] | 2.690 | 2.690 |
Number of reflections | 23546 | |
<I/σ(I)> | 23 | 3.7 |
Completeness [%] | 99.0 | 90 |
Crystallization Conditions
crystal ID | method | pH | temperature | details |
1 | VAPOR DIFFUSION, HANGING DROP | 7.5 | 298 | 0.1M HEPES, O.1M Nacl, 1.6M Ammonium sulphate, pH 7.5, VAPOR DIFFUSION, HANGING DROP, temperature 298K |
